Abstract

Abstract The intestinal mucus layer remains a challenging biological barrier to cross for nanoformulations. We report the assembly of zwitterionic micelles with 2‐methacryloyloxyethyl phosphorylcholine as the zwitterionic entity in the corona‐forming part of the amphiphilic block copolymers. These ca. 200 nm micelles do not have inherent cytotoxicity in Caco‐2 cells for a 24 h incubation time. The time‐resolved crossing of the mucus layer in Caco‐2/HT29‐MTX‐E12 co‐cultures of these spherical micelles with narrow polydispersity is shown.
